Yes I've noticed this also, but don't use zend studio.  By default php 
is normally configured to hide notices, so one way to find the issues is 
to run with php reporting notices instead of just warnings.

I'll take any patches that help clean up these issues.  At least when 
we're not preparing for a release..

Joel Rydbeck wrote:

>I've been using Zend Studio to do a lot of my development lately --mainly because it has a solid debugger.  Whenever I run a debug on vtiger, I notice there are a lot of issues.  Roughly every view/form post/etc results in 5-20 of the following issues:
>
>*	Undeclared variables
>*	Include headers reference files that don't exist
>*	Errors ranging from invalid type assignments to more severe items
>
>Is there something we could put in the release process that would clean this up?  Does anyone else use Zend Studio?  Any interest?  I haven't run a profiler on the app yet, but I'm guessing we could squeeze some performance out of it.
